Maybe that will change next year once chronic meds at GP will be priced the same as ops. So GPs who signed up these PTS can continue to see them at ops price (or at least cannot taichi them to ops)
Consult fee difference?
Remember, GP make money from meds.
The few chronic patient they have they earn a lot from their combi meds
Worth the GP time.
Now meds they can't make money
Spend 15 minutes telling u about weight loss
Can see 5 urti each at 60 bucks liao.

300 bucks Vs 28 dollars.
Want earn more must report kpi.
Reason I leave the system is to avoid all these oversight
Now u want to track kpi.
Worth my effort or not is another question

No choice u force me to accept healthier sg
But I have a choice about whether to be actively participating.
Those healthier sg patient..after my first health plan...I chin chye a bit till they go away lo.
Go ops best. Haha.
I see my acute conditions earn more and not so stressed.

U want healthier sg?
Make sure all GP properly trained.
Phased out MBBS GP.
Gdfm have to get m.med eventually else clinic license revoked

Raise ops price so GP is not more expensive.
Then u spread the load and raise quality of primary care
